Spanish-Language Podcast Studio Sold

Exile Content Studio, Hollywood’s Latinx-led TV/Film content producer, has purchased Spanish-language podcast network and production company Dixo. Financial details of the deal were not disclosed.

Dixo began its foray into podcasting in Mexico in 2005. With more than 5,000 published productions to-date, spanning genres and categories that include science fiction, cinema, economics, literature, politics, wellness, nutrition, and more.

In making the announcement, María Teresa Pérez, Chief Operating Officer of Exile Content, said, “It gives me great pleasure to welcome Dixo and its visionary leader Dany Saadia, to Exile Content Studio. All of us at Exile are excited over the opportunity to not only grow our podcasting efforts and generate new IP, but to lead the charge on the growth and development of the podcast industry across the U.S. and Latin America.”

An early adopter of the podcast format, CEO and founder Saadia launched Dixo 16 years ago with the belief that Spanish-language podcasting could transform storytelling in Latin America. Saadia said, “From its inception, Dixo has been a bootstrap startup, so we’re thrilled to be joining Exile with its tremendous resources to expand the reach of podcasts and continue to create quality content for audiences in the U.S. and Latin America.”
